An 1850s Living Room's Makeover Is "Giving Major Bridgerton Vibes"
Briefly

Brenda Stearns transformed her 1850s living room from mustard yellow to a more personalized aesthetic by stripping away layers of wallpaper and repainting. Initially, the room's history inspired her to embrace wallpaper again, and she chose designs that blended old with new, emphasizing textures and patterns. The renovations not only enhanced the room's ambiance but also involved her family in the process, turning the project into a cherished memory. Brenda's efforts resulted in a space that is warm and inviting, reminiscent of period elegance.
